





eScripts are a modern, convenient way to manage your prescriptions digitally. At Warners Bay Pharmacy, we provide an efficient and secure service that allows you to receive and manage your prescriptions electronically.
This system eliminates the need for paper prescriptions, making it easier to access your medications without the hassle of keeping track of paper documents. eScripts can be sent directly from your doctor to our pharmacy, and we will prepare your medications for pickup or delivery. eScripts are designed to offer a seamless, secure and paper-free solution for managing prescriptions. Our pharmacists at Warners Bay Pharmacy will work with you to ensure your eScript prescriptions are processed quickly and accurately.
To use eScripts, all you need is a valid email address and an eScript-enabled doctor. Once your doctor sends your prescription electronically, you can have it fulfilled at Warners Bay Pharmacy. If you're new to eScripts, our pharmacy staff can guide you through the process to ensure a smooth experience. This service is available for most patients, whether you are receiving a new prescription or requesting a refill.
Yes, eScripts are highly secure. They are sent through encrypted channels from your doctor to the pharmacy, ensuring that your personal health information is protected. This system is designed with privacy in mind, so you can be confident that your prescriptions are handled securely. Furthermore, you will receive an electronic version of your prescription that is stored safely for easy access.
eScripts can be used for most prescription medications, including ongoing treatments and new prescriptions. However, there are some restrictions, such as certain controlled substances or medications that require paper-based prescriptions due to legal regulations. It’s important to check with your healthcare provider and pharmacist to confirm if eScripts are suitable for all your prescriptions.
